Output 255d61ec70606972ebdc4a18c8fefa80d797925e62a23f338a0d490900661c83:62

value
593713
script pubkey
OP_0 OP_PUSHBYTES_20 35872504659b8d93eac1b5423f87c3b361aa291d
address
bc1qxkrj2pr9nwxe86kpk4prlp7rkds652gaj0gksg
transaction
255d61ec70606972ebdc4a18c8fefa80d797925e62a23f338a0d490900661c83
spent
true